Scotia International Equity Index Tracker ETF (SITI): A High-Yield Gateway to Global Markets

The Scotia International Equity Index Tracker ETF (SITI) has declared a CAD 0.348 dividend, reigniting interest in its compelling blend of income generation and broad international equity exposure. With its price recently hitting a 52-week high of CAD 30.33, SITI's dividend yield now stands at 2.75%, offering investors a rare combination of steady income and diversified access to developed markets outside North America. The Dividend Yield: A Competitive Advantage

At 2.75%, SITI's weighted average dividend yield is notably higher than the trailing 12-month yield of the S&P 500 Index (1.56%) and competitive with many global equity ETF peers. While the declared dividend of CAD 0.348 translates to an annualized yield of approximately 2.94% based on the current share price (CAD 0.348 × 4 / CAD 30.33), this aligns closely with its stated yield.

This yield is bolstered by SITI's low net expense ratio of 0.22%, which is below the average for international equity ETFs. Lower fees mean more of the fund's returns flow to investors, enhancing its appeal for those seeking income without excessive costs.

Global Exposure at a Bargain Price

SITI tracks the Solactive GBS Developed Markets ex North America Large & Mid Cap CAD Index, which invests in large and mid-cap companies across developed markets outside the U.S. and Canada. This includes heavyweights in sectors like healthcare, technology, and consumer staples in regions such as Europe and Asia.

The fund's 98.41% stock allocation ensures robust equity exposure, while its CAD hedging mechanism reduces currency risk for Canadian investors. This hedging feature contrasts with unhedged rivals like the Vanguard FTSE Dev All Cap ex Nth Am Idx ETF CAD-hgd (VDAA), which may expose investors to fluctuations in foreign currencies.

Performance: Outpacing Canadian Benchmarks

Year-to-date, SITI has delivered a 10.68% total return, outperforming the S&P/TSX 60 Index Total Return (8.12%). This suggests the ETF's focus on non-North American markets is paying off in an environment where global economic recovery and corporate earnings are driving equity gains.

However, it's crucial to note that SITI's performance relative to peers like the Mackenzie International Equity Index ETF (MIE) and VDAA varies. For instance, VDAA, with its broader all-cap exposure, may capture growth opportunities SITI misses. Investors should assess their risk tolerance and growth-income balance before choosing between these options.

Risk Considerations and Technical Outlook

While SITI's yield and diversification are compelling, risks persist. Geopolitical tensions, inflationary pressures, or a strong Canadian dollar could dampen returns. Technical analysis currently signals a “Strong Buy”, with the ETF hovering near its 52-week high, but volatility remains a factor.

The fund's 6.60% turnover ratio suggests minimal trading costs, but its $575 million in assets under management is modest compared to larger ETFs, potentially impacting liquidity. The average daily volume of 1,353 units is low, so investors should consider trading costs when entering or exiting positions.
